Synopsis by Hal Erickson

A Canadian political discussion program, Decision emanated from the studios of Montréal's CBMT. The program was essentially the voice of the Parti Quebecois, which took charge of the Québec government in 1976. After four years as a local Montréal offering, the series was picked up by the entire CBC network on January 17, 1980, virtually on the eve of a key sovereignty referendum. Montreal Gazette correspondent L. Ian MacDonald hosted, while the guests were drawn almost exclusively from the ranks of the French-Canadian political scene. The final coast-to-coast episode of Decision was seen on May 19, 1980.
